3.6 Electrical Installation
3.6.1 Connection to power section
80
The connection to the power section is normally made via the connection
terminals:
•
L1/L, L2/N, L3, PE for the mains-side supply voltage.
The phase sequence does not matter.
•
DC+, DC-, PE for DC link coupling
•
U, V, W, PE for the connection to the motor
•
BR, DC+, PE for an external brake resistor

The number and the arrangement of the connection terminals used depend
on the variable frequency drive's size and model.
NOTICE
The variable frequency drive must always be connected with
ground potential via a grounding conductor (PE).
